The People Score for the Prostate Cancer Score in 48187, Canton, Michigan is 41 when comparing 34,000 ZIP Codes in the United States.
An estimate of 97.18 percent of the residents in 48187 has some form of health insurance. 25.87 percent of the residents have some type of public health insurance like Medicare, Medicaid, Veterans Affairs (VA), or TRICARE. About 85.37 percent of the residents have private health insurance, either through their employer or direct purchase.
A resident in 48187 would have to travel an average of 6.56 miles to reach the nearest hospital with an emergency room, Beaumont Hospital - Wayne. In a 20-mile radius, there are 53,332 healthcare providers accessible to residents living in 48187, Canton, Michigan.

**The Importance of Early Detection: A Proactive Approach**
Early detection is paramount in the fight against prostate cancer. Regular screenings, including PSA tests and digital rectal exams, are essential for identifying the disease at its earliest stages when treatment is most effective.
